Abstract
This paper proposes control of 3-level inverter with small DC-link capacitance and grid filter inductance for high speed motor drive system where regeneration and hold-up time are unnecessary. The controller consists of three simultaneously operating sub-controllers; High speed motor controller for flux weakening and maximum torque per ampere (MTPA) control, neutral voltage controller for DC-link voltage balancing, and active damping controller for DC-link stabilization. They are devised to operate in given DC-link voltage with their restricted voltage regions, avoiding interference among them. The analysis and design of each sub-controller and over all integration of them is discussed. The feasibility and performance of proposed control method is verified experimentally.
